Caroline Nicholls was born in 1840 in Sedgley, Staffordshire, England, the child of Richard Cooper And Ruth Cooper. In 1851, Caroline Nicholls resided in Bilston, Staffordshire, England. Caroline Nicholls married John Nicholls, and had children including Betsy Nicholls, Elizabeth Nicholls, Emma Nicholls, Enoch Nichols, Hannah Nicholls, John Edward Nicholls, John Henry Nicholls, Joseph Thomas Nicholls, Richard Nicholls, Rose Hannah Nicholls, Rosina Nicholls, Samuel Nicholls, Sarah Ann Nicholls. Caroline Nicholls passed away in 1907 in 62 Robinson Street, Stalybridge, Cheshire, England.
